06 - Cargo Operations Including Equipment › N/A - No Subsystem › Other (cargo)
Issued 14 April 2025
Resolved
The inert gas system referred to in paragraph 5.5.3.1 shall be designed, constructed, and tested in accordance with the Fire Safety Systems code. Conduct permanent repairs to inert gas system. Demonstrate operational readiness of all alarms, visual, audible, and shutdowns prior to cargo ops.
74 Solas(04) II-2/4.5.5.3.2
Condition: Damaged By Earlier Event
Action required: 705 - Other - as specified
Due 14 April 2025
Resolved 15 April 2025
Resolution: Received class report. #1 blower gaskets replaced. See documents.

07 - Fire Safety › N/A - No Subsystem › Maintenance of Fire protection systems
Issued 10 February 2023
Resolved
SOLAS 74 (a) 2004 Cons. II-2/14.1.1 The purpose of his regulation is to maintain and monitor the effectiveness of the fire safety measures the ship is provided with the following functional requirements shall be meet: Fire protection systems and fire-fighting systems and appliances shall be maintained ready for use.
PSCO observed the hyper mist leaking over the #1 and #2 Aux Engines (Generators). The engineering department initially attempted to repair the system by closing the valves to the system. Provide technician report and class report confirming the system is repaired prior to departure. PSCO also observed a water bottle over the #1 generator hyper mist sprinkler head.
Condition: Improper/Lack of Maintenance
Action required: 17 - Rectify deficiencies prior to departure
Resolved 19 February 2023
Resolution: Received class report, system repairs and tested.

06 - Cargo Operations Including Equipment › N/A - No Subsystem › Cargo operation
Issued 11 December 2020
Resolved
Each item of remote operating equipment such as an...emergency shutdown device must perform its intended function. Emergency shutdown for #2 cargo pump did not shut down pump. ESD's on deck and in cargo control room activate required alarms, but steam still flows through and turns cargo pump. Pump RPMs are not changed when ESD is activated. 33 CFR 156.170(c)(5)
Action required: 40 - Rectify deficiencies prior to next US port after sailing foreign
Resolved 22 December 2020
Resolution: Class confirmed repairs. See attached report from class.
06 - Cargo Operations Including Equipment › N/A - No Subsystem › Cargo operation
Issued 11 December 2020
Resolved
Each item of remote operating equipment such as an...emergency shutdown device must perform its intended function. Emergency shutdown for #3 cargo pump did not shut down pump. ESDs on deck and in cargo control room activate required alarms, but steam still flows through and turns cargo pump. Pump RPMs decrease but pump does not stop entirely when ESD is activated. 33 CFR 156.170(c)(5)
Action required: 40 - Rectify deficiencies prior to next US port after sailing foreign
Resolved 22 December 2020
Resolution: Class confirmed repairs. See attached report from class.

Deck/Cargo › Inert Gas System › Boiler Uptake
Issued 5 October 2017
Resolved
Code:1899 Cite:74SOLAS(04)II-2/4.5.5.3.1 Action:10c The IG System shall be capable of inerting, purging, and gas-freeing empty tanks and maintaining the atmosphere in cargo tanks with the required oxygen content. Vsl unable to produce <5% IG due to the dirty filter of the boiler system. Crew cleaned the filter and ran the IG system properly prior to MI departure. Issued 10c for documentation/future observation.
Condition: Improper/Lack of Maintenance
Action required: 705 - Other - as specified
Due 5 October 2017
Resolved 5 October 2017
Resolution: Crew cleaned the filter and ran the IG system properly prior to MI departure.
